The Accessibility and Control of Methylphenidate in Europe

Methylphenidate, {commonly known as Ritalin or Concerta|referred to as Ritalin or Concerta, is a medicinal compound stimulating the central nervous system. While its primary utilization is in the treatment of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), it also has purposes in treating narcolepsy and certain other neurological conditions. Across Europe, the accessibility of methylphenidate varies significantly from country to country. Some countries have more stringent controls surrounding its prescription and supply, while others are more permissive.

  • Factors influencing these differences include cultural attitudes towards ADHD, healthcare systems' structure, and individual countries' legal frameworks.
  • In some European nations, methylphenidate is readily available by prescription, while in others, it may require more stringent documentation from healthcare professionals.
  • Furthermore, there are often variations in the specific types of methylphenidate that are approved for use in different countries.

An Economic Burden of ADHD Medication in Europe

The rising cost of ADHD medication presents a significant challenge across European nations. Individuals with ADHD often face high out-of-pocket expenses for drugs, placing a strain on their economic resources. Moreover, the impact of untreated ADHD can be substantial, leading to reduced productivity, increased absenteeism, and higher healthcare expenses. Governments and healthcare systems are struggling with the dilemma of providing affordable access to medication while managing the overall social impact of ADHD. Some European countries have implemented initiatives to mitigate this burden, such as negotiating lower drug prices or expanding insurance coverage for ADHD treatment. However, more efforts are needed to ensure that individuals with ADHD have access to the care they need without facing excessive financial challenges.

Availability of Methylphenidate Across European Nations

Prescribing practices for Ritalin, a medication primarily used to treat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), display significant differences across European nations. Some countries, such as UK, tend to prescribe Ritalin at higher rates compared to others, like Italy. This gap can be attributed to a blend of factors, including social norms towards ADHD, availability of treatment, and variations in diagnostic criteria.

The allocation of Ritalin can also be influenced by regulations implemented at the national level. Some countries may have tighter restrictions on the prescription and dispensing of ADHD medications, while others may have a more permissive approach. These variations in access to Ritalin can have significant implications for individuals with ADHD and their overall health.

European Perspectives on ADHD Diagnosis and Methylphenidate

There present distinct variations in how continental nations approach the identification of Attention-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) and the prescribing of methylphenidate, a common stimulant medication. National factors play a significant impact on attitudes towards ADHD, leading variations in diagnostic criteria and treatment approaches. For instance, certain European countries tend to adopt a more reserved stance on ADHD diagnosis, emphasizing the relevance of thorough evaluations. In contrast, other countries may approach ADHD with higher acceptance and encourage more liberal prescribing practices for methylphenidate. This spectrum in perspectives reflects the complex interplay between cultural norms, medical systems, and individual beliefs about ADHD.
